The future of the global big data analytic system MRO service market looks promising with opportunities in the aerospace, automotive, manufacturing, energy, and healthcare markets. The global big data analytic system MRO service market is expected to reach an estimated $22 billion by 2035 with a CAGR of 5.7% from 2026 to 2035. The major drivers for this market are the increasing demand for data driven maintenance insights, the rising need for predictive analytics in MRO services, and the growing adoption of big data analytics solutions.
- Lucintel forecasts that, within the data source category, operational data is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period.
- Within the end use category, healthcare is expected to witness the highest growth.
- In terms of region, APAC is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period.

- Adoption of Predictive Maintenance : Companies are increasingly utilizing big data analytics to predict equipment failures before they occur. This trend enables proactive maintenance scheduling, reducing downtime and operational costs. By analyzing sensor data, historical records, and real-time inputs, organizations can identify patterns indicating potential issues, leading to more efficient resource allocation and improved asset lifespan. The impact is a significant enhancement in operational efficiency and a reduction in unplanned outages, especially in industries like aviation, manufacturing, and energy.
- Integration of IoT and Big Data Technologies : The convergence of Internet of Things (IoT) devices with big data analytics is transforming MRO services. IoT sensors continuously collect data from machinery, providing real-time insights into equipment health. This integration facilitates remote monitoring, faster diagnostics, and automated alerts, streamlining maintenance processes. The impact includes increased accuracy in diagnostics, reduced manual inspections, and enhanced safety. Industries such as aerospace and automotive are leveraging IoT-enabled analytics for smarter maintenance strategies.

- Increasing Adoption of Predictive Maintenance: The shift from traditional reactive maintenance to predictive maintenance is a significant driver. Big data analytics allows companies to predict equipment failures before they occur, reducing unplanned downtime and maintenance costs. This proactive approach improves asset lifespan and operational efficiency, which is highly attractive across industries such as aerospace, manufacturing, and energy. As organizations recognize the cost savings and reliability benefits, adoption rates are accelerating, fueling market expansion. The ability to leverage large datasets for actionable insights is transforming MRO services into more strategic, data-driven functions.

- High Implementation and Maintenance Costs: Deploying advanced big data analytics systems involves significant capital expenditure on hardware, software, and skilled personnel. Small and medium-sized enterprises may find these costs prohibitive, limiting their ability to adopt such technologies. Additionally, ongoing maintenance, updates, and system integration require continuous investment, which can strain budgets. The complexity of integrating new analytics tools with existing legacy systems further complicates deployment. These high costs can slow down adoption rates and restrict market expansion, particularly in regions with limited financial resources.
